TrueDelta Reviews the Seat Room and Comfort of the 2022 Kia Seltos

2022 Kia Seltos Seat Room and Comfort: Pros
YearComment
2021 Compared to most other small crossovers, the Kia Seltos has a much roomier rear seat. Rear legroom is a generous 38 inches. Few people will need to step up to a larger crossover unless they need to seat more than four people. The competing Mazda CX-30 (36.3 inches of rear legroom) and the related Hyundai Kona (34.6 inches of rear legroom) have more cramped and much more cramped rear seats, respectively. In fact, the Seltos has about as much room for rear seat passengers as the one-size-up Sportage. (The Sportage will no doubt grow when it is next redesigned.) The Seltos' rear seat passengers can select between two seatback angles. I found even the most upright not as upright as I would have liked, but impressions here will vary. see full Kia Seltos review

TrueDelta Reviews the Seat Room and Comfort of the 2017 Volkswagen Golf / GTI

2017 Volkswagen Golf / GTI Seat Room and Comfort: Pros
YearComment
2016 As I've noted before (when reviewing the e-Golf), the seventh-generation Golf's front seats are shaped and padded to provide nearly ideal comfort and support in daily driving. The CX-5's driver seat also fit me well, but not quite as well as the Volkswagen's. Compared to other compact hatchbacks and its ancestors, the current Golf has a roomy rear seat. I can sit behind my 5-9 self with about five inches of air ahead of my knees. Unless unusually tall people populate both rows, the amount of space should be beyond adequate. Compare the Golf SportWagen's rear seat to that in the CX-5, and a funny thing happens. On paper, the Mazda provides about 3.5 more inches of legroom. When sitting behind myself in both vehicles, though, I had about half as much space ahead of my knees in the CX-5. I've noticed in the past that VW measures rear legroom very conservatively, and apparently they continue to do so. The Golf's interior is roomier than the official specs suggest. Plus its rear seat passengers get air vents. The Mazda's do not. This said, I'm not entirely comfortable in the Golf SportWagen's rear seat. To me it feels overly reclined. In neither the GSW nor the CX-5 is the degree of recline adjustable. It is in some compact crossovers. see full Volkswagen Golf / GTI review
